This fully welded trailer hitch receiver bolts onto your vehicle's frame with no welding required. Powder coated steel is sturdy and corrosion resistant.


Features:

  • Custom fit is designed specifically for your vehicle
  • Precision, robotic welding maximizes strength and improves fit
  • Bolt-on installation - no welding required
    • Complete hardware kit and installation instructions included
  • Lifetime technical support from the experts at etrailer.com
  • Gloss black powder coat finish over protective base coat offers superior rust resistance
  • Ball mount, pin and clip sold separately
  • Hitch assembled in the USA
    • Mounting hardware may be imported


Specs:

  • Receiver opening: 2" x 2"
  • Rating: Class III
    • Maximum gross trailer weight: 4,000 lbs
    • Maximum tongue weight: 400 lbs
  • Limited lifetime warranty

Hitch arrived on time and in good condition. The only trouble I had was determining which holes in the frame to pull the bolts through. I looked at the hitch and it appeared to me that the rear hole was offset and since there are three holes in each frame rail I assumed that the rear bolt went into the outer hole. WRONG. Both bolts go straight in line with each other, into the two holes in the frame that are closest to the muffler. Once I discovered that I had to move one bolt over about 3/4 of an inch into the correct hole but I was able to do it rather easily.

I used a floor jack to raise the hitch up into place which means I didn't need another person to help.

Mostly easy to install. The video and instructions are great until it came time to fish the carriage bolts (the reason for 4 stars instead of 5). The video shows fishing from the side of the frame rails which our 2012 is sealed off. There was a reviewer that recommended taking the tail lights, bumper cover, bumper off, that should be steps 2, 3 and 4 after dropping the muffler. You don't even need the fish wires with the bumper off. Although when replacing the bumper cover, pay more attention to the center anchor of the bumper cover than I did. All in all though, this was an easy install. If I had to do it again, with an extra set of hands, can be done easily in an hour ... the second time, without the wiring. The install video for this hitch indicates that routing the carriage bolts through the end of the frame rail is easy. On my installation this was not the case at all, and was virtually impossible without removing the rear bumper cover and bumper itself. Once the taillights, bumper cover and bumper itself were removed the installation of the mounting bolts was very easy. I defiantly recommend having a second set of hands for installing the hitch to the bolts, and the use of a floor jack is also recommended. Once installed the hitch looks great and is very solid.   • Why Can't I Find a Higher Capacity Hitch for 2011 Ford Edge
    After taking a look at the owner's manual for a 2011 Ford Edge, I found that the largest trailer that could be towed with this vehicle would be one weighing 3,500 lbs and this is only for the AWD 3.5L Class II (lower capacities are listed for the others). The highest capacity hitch that is offered for the Edge is one with a 4,000 lb towing capacity like the Curt Trailer Hitch, # C13067. 4,000 lbs already exceeds the vehicle's towing capacity so this is why manufacturers do not offer an...

  • Can Curt Trailer Hitch C13067 on a 2013 Ford Edge Sport Support 375 Pounds of Scooter and Carrier
    Curt trailer hitch # C13067 is rated for 400 pounds tongue weight. Since the combined weight of the scooter and carrier is 275 pounds the hitch has more than enough capacity for this application. But you also have to look at the tongue weight capacity of the vehicle. It looks like at most the 2013 Ford Edge can have a tongue weight capacity of 350 pounds. It really depends on the specific model and whether or not the vehicle has the factory tow package. Models with the 2.0 liter motor...

  • Can a Weight Distribution Hitch be Used on a 2014 Ford Edge with Factory 2 Inch Receiver
    I am not sure why Ford is calling a hitch with a 2 inch receiver a Class II when everyone else calls it a Class III. But if you check the hitch for a sticker or look up towing information in the owners manual it might say somewhere if you can use weight distribution or not. Class II hitches are not rated for use with weight distribution because they are not designed to handle the additional stress. If you cannot find the information on the hitch or in the owners manual then you would want...

  • Trailer Hitch with Highest Tongue Weight Capacity for a 2009 Ford Edge
    The hitches for your 2009 Ford Edge that offer the highest tongue weight, such as # 75992, are rated for 400 pounds tongue weight. However, what matters is the lowest rated component in the system and in this case it is the vehicle. At most it is rated for 350 pounds tongue weight if it has the optional towing package. With the standard towing package it is rated for 200 pounds tongue weight.
